Ticket: Reminder job failing signature check

The Thistledown clinic reminder job has been failing since last night's deploy. The job pulls its message templates from the Larkfield bundle, verifies the bundle signature, then queues SMS reminders. Verification now fails with a key mismatch, so no reminders went out this morning. Root cause: the bundle was re-signed during the pipeline migration but the job still trusts the old key. Fix: update the job's trust store with the new signing key, shown below.

signing key of fahof-tahof = bky13_rpcUNgEnLB4i2

Runbook: canary gating for the Tidepool deploy pipeline

A canary promotes automatically only if all three gates pass for 30 minutes: error rate under 0.5%, p95 latency within 10% of baseline, and no new alert fires tagged to the release. If any gate fails, the canary is frozen — not rolled back — pending an engineer's decision. Support should not advise customers that a fix has shipped until the canary reaches 100%. Current gate status and override history for every release are shown on the dashboard here.

wiki page, bagaf-fawip: https://harbor.tolvaqsys.local/pages/repo/pages/secrets/eac969ffc71f356b

## Archiving Cold Storage — Support Notes

Hey folks — when a Frostbin bucket goes 90 days without reads, the archiver sweeps it nightly. Customers can request restores; just file a thaw ticket. Restores from the Lanford vault need a signed request, and the deploy key for that is right here.

rollout seal: bky4_x7Gc

Ticket: Staging env misconfigured for Siftgate bloom filter

The bloom layer in front of the Pellet KV store is rejecting all lookups in staging because the env file was copied from the dev template without credentials. False-positive tuning values are fine; only the auth line is missing. To unblock the weekly demo, the Pellet admission secret must be set on the following line.

env line for yaguf-fajop: LEDGER_TOKEN13=fb08984397349